Open for you, from you and in you



So often we look outside ourselves for that love which will make us feel fulfilled and happy about life.  There is no human that can give you that kind of love, what they can do is open your eyes a little with their image of you, allowing you to see a bit of your own true worth.  But you will never find true happiness until you know your own worth as who you are for yourself, not as how someone else sees you.  If we turn to others to know our value, then we can never know ourselves and how much we have to offer.  The love of anyone outside you is never as complete and ever lasting as the love you can know from within, for a lifetime of happiness and acceptance of yourself as you are.  We each have our demons, anyone outside you is fighting their own and will have to be very well balanced to stand steady enough to be their own and your corner stone.  Their are guides in our history that have laid down great levels of love to help you see your own worth, death has not stopped their power from trying to reach you and open your heart to itself.  Each has given an instruction manual that helps you walk the path to a true love that is rooted within you.
It is as if God were waiting behind the door of your heart, every heart, and once you realize that anything blocking the door is inside you, then you can see how to push that junk aside to swing the door open.  The only thing that can ever keep us from opening the door is the barrier we put up that keeps us from accepting our own worth in love.  
Each of us must know our own love first, then we can see the doorway that is always being pounded on by God's love, and is begging us to open it.  When you know your own worth then you can see love from another person as an extension of your own love, you will never let that outer love be the determining factor of your value.  You are the guardian of the doorway to your own heart, drop you weapons, open it for yourself and then you can really share it with the world.
